  • Bangladesh Railway Minister Md. Nurul Islam Sujan has said that the Khulna-Mongla railway line will become operational by the end of this year.
  • Minister Sujan said most of the work of around 45 kilometres railway line has been completed.
  • The Mongla-Khulna railway line is funded by the government of India Line of Credit (LOC). The project is scheduled to be over by the end of this year.
  • The Khulna-Mongla railway project is part of the first Line of Credit extended by India to Bangladesh in 2010.
  • According to the IRCON International Ltd, a total 31 bridges and 108 culverts have been built for the train link.
  • The Rupsha bridge was completed on 25 June this year. The Minister said that the main challenge in the project was the construction of the Rupsha bridge which has been completed now.
  • Outlining the benefit of the Khulna-Mongla line, Nurul Islam Sujan said that it will lead to enhanced trade through the Mongla port to foreign destinations.
  • Speaking about other railway projects, the minister said that the construction work of the Padma Bridge Railway project from Dhaka to Bhanga will be complete by June 2023 after which the Kushtia-Khulna railway communication will commence.
